Transaction 4e6827eeeb91134ded95c059a94c7256d39bd668828e95f092aed340ebf826ef

5 Input
1 Outputs
  • 4e6827eeeb91134ded95c059a94c7256d39bd668828e95f092aed340ebf826ef:0
  • value  1000000000
    address  1Bsh9A5DqBb3ju2gGeMgEHr336Ljj4yQ8k